PIC17C762-16E/PT Equivalent & Substitute Parts
Part Overview
The PIC17C762-16E/PT is an 8-bit microcontroller from Microchip Technology's PIC® 17C series, featuring 16KB OTP program memory, 678 bytes of RAM, and 16MHz operation. This device integrates I2C, SPI, and UART/USART connectivity with 66 I/O pins in an 80-TQFP surface mount package. The part is classified as obsolete, making identification of functionally equivalent alternatives essential for ongoing system support and new design implementations.

Substitute Part Grouping Explanation
Substitution of the PIC17C762-16E/PT is determined by strict equivalence across core functional parameters: processor architecture (PIC), memory configuration (16KB OTP program memory, 678 bytes RAM), clock speed (16MHz), I/O count (66 pins), connectivity interfaces (I2C, SPI, UART/USART), peripheral set (Brown-out Detect/Reset, POR, PWM, WDT), and package form factor (80-TQFP 12x12).
The primary substitute identified is the PIC17C762-16I/PT, which maintains identical specifications across all functional parameters. The distinction between these parts lies in temperature rating and product status: the -16E variant operates across -40°C to 125°C and is obsolete, while the -16I variant operates across -40°C to 85°C and maintains active product status.

Engineering Selection Recommendations
The PIC17C762-16I/PT serves as the direct functional equivalent to the PIC17C762-16E/PT. Both devices are ROHS3 compliant and carry identical MSL ratings, ensuring compatibility with modern manufacturing and environmental standards.
Selection between these parts depends on application temperature requirements. The -16E variant supports extended operation to 125°C, while the -16I variant operates to 85°C. For applications requiring the full -40°C to 125°C range, the -16E specification must be maintained. For applications operating within -40°C to 85°C, the -16I variant is available with active product status and current supply chain support.
Frequently Asked Questions (FAQ)
Q: Can the PIC17C762-16I/PT replace the PIC17C762-16E/PT in all applications?
A: Functional replacement is possible when the application operating temperature does not exceed 85°C. The -16I variant maintains identical core specifications, memory configuration, I/O count, and peripheral set. Applications requiring operation above 85°C require the -16E specification.
Q: What is the significance of the temperature rating difference?
A: The -16E variant (-40°C to 125°C) supports extended high-temperature operation, while the -16I variant (-40°C to 85°C) operates within a narrower range. This difference affects device reliability and performance in thermal environments. Selection must align with actual application temperature requirements.
Q: Are both parts pin-compatible?
A: Yes. Both the PIC17C762-16E/PT and PIC17C762-16I/PT use the 80-TQFP (12x12) package with 66 I/O pins. Pin assignments, signal definitions, and electrical characteristics remain identical, enabling direct board-level substitution.
Q: What is the product status difference, and why does it matter?
A: The -16E is classified as obsolete, indicating Microchip has discontinued active production and support. The -16I maintains active status, ensuring ongoing availability, technical support, and supply chain reliability. For new designs or long-term production, the -16I variant is preferred.
Q: Are there compliance or certification differences?
A: Both parts carry identical ROHS3 compliance and MSL 3 ratings. No compliance or certification differences exist between the variants.
